fell in defroster vents..

If i posted this in the wrong forum, feel free to move it.

I was changing the speakers in my dash today and i dropped a screw and 2 sockets into my defroster vents...yes i know, two of them. i got one out by breaking/bending one of those extendable magnetic sticks. But i just couldnt find or get the other socket and screw out...is it bad that they are in there? or is there any way to get them out of there.

Re: fell in defroster vents..

Just pull the screws from the dashboard top and under the face. Move it out
of the way and take out the defroster vents. Its only a couple of screws
and fish them out.

PIA yes...............I don't think the screws and socket will get to the fan or
squirrel cage but may jamb up your blend door movement.

Re: fell in defroster vents..

ever try attaching a small hose (such as engine vacuum hose which is flexible) to your larger vacuum hose(shop vac or equivalent) coupling the two with a rag and or duct tape and try to vacuum them out.
Has worked for me in the past!
